
IPL 2025: Rishabh Pant records duck on LSG debut
What's the story
Rishabh Pant's highly-anticipated debut as the skipper of Lucknow Super Giants (LSG) in IPL 2025 went awry.
Facing his former side, Delhi Capitals, at the ACA-VDCA Stadium in Visakhapatnam, Pant was dismissed for a six-ball duck.
The 27-year-old Indian cricketer misjudged a delivery from fellow India teammate Kuldeep Yadav and ended up gifting his wicket to long-off.

Kuldeep gets Pant again
As mentioned, Pant fell to Kuldeep in the 14th over. He had joined Nicholas Pooran when DC were cruising on 133/2 in 11.4 overs.
According to ESPNcricinfo, this was the third instance of Kuldeep dismissing Pant in three IPL innings.
Pant has a strike-rate of 92.00 against the wrist-spinner in the tournament. His tally includes 13 dot balls.

Most expensive player in IPL history
Lucknow Super Giants bagged Pant's services for a whopping ₹27 crore during the IPL 2025 mega auction last year.
The massive bid made Pant the most expensive player in IPL history.
Before this, he had made his mark with Delhi Capitals since his IPL debut in 2016. He is still the highest run-scorer for the Capitals, with 3,284 runs.
